import csv
import random
def update_main_quest_rewards(input_path, output_path=None):
if output_path is None:
output_path = input_path
with open(input_path, 'r', encoding='utf-8') as f:
lines = f.readlines()
fieldnames = lines[2].strip().split(',')
data_lines = lines[3:]
reader = csv.DictReader(data_lines, fieldnames=fieldnames)
main_quests = []
other_quests = []
for row in reader:
if int(row.get('category', 0)) == 1:
main_quests.append(row)
else:
other_quests.append(row)
main_quests.sort(key=lambda x: int(x['id']))
rewards_history = []
current_10000001 = 2400
current_10000002 = 50
for i, row in enumerate(main_quests):
if i == 0:
current_10000001 = 2400
current_10000002 = 50
else:
increase_10000001 = random.randint(400, 450)
current_10000001 += increase_10000001
current_10000002 += 50
row['rewards'] = f"item_10000001_{current_10000001},item_10000002_{current_10000002}"
rewards_history.append({
'id': row['id'],
'reward_10000001': current_10000001,
'reward_10000002': current_10000002
})
all_rows = main_quests + other_quests
all_rows.sort(key=lambda x: int(x['id']))
with open(output_path, 'w', encoding='utf-8', newline='') as f:
f.writelines(lines[:3])
writer = csv.DictWriter(f, fieldnames=fieldnames)
writer.writerows(all_rows)
print(f"更新完成,共更新 {len(main_quests)} 条主线任务的奖励配置")
print("\n奖励增长预览前10条:")
for i, record in enumerate(rewards_history[:10], 1):
print(f" 任务ID {record['id']}: item_10000001={record['reward_10000001']}, item_10000002={record['reward_10000002']}")
print(f"\n最后一条主线任务奖励:")
last_record = rewards_history[-1]
print(f" 任务ID {last_record['id']}: item_10000001={last_record['reward_10000001']}, item_10000002={last_record['reward_10000002']}")
return rewards_history
